动态网站设计作业
嗯,用户让我写一篇关于动态网站设计作业的文章,标题和内容都要写,我得确定文章的结构,标题已经给了,是“动态网站设计作业:从静态到动态的网站设计演变”,看起来挺专业的,应该能吸引读者。 部分需要不少于1887个字,所以得详细展开,我应该先介绍什么是动态网站设计,然后讨论其重要性,接着分析传统静态设计的局限性,再讲动态设计的优势,最后总结一下未来的发展趋势。
用户可能是一个学生,正在完成作业,所以文章需要清晰易懂,结构分明,可能需要包括一些实际例子,比如使用JavaScript、CSS的动态效果,或者响应式设计等。
我应该先定义动态网站设计,解释它与静态设计的区别,然后讨论传统设计的问题,比如加载时间长、用户体验差,详细说明动态设计如何解决这些问题,比如使用JavaScript和CSS来实现交互,响应式设计提升用户体验。
可以举一些实际应用的例子,比如电商网站的订单确认页,或者社交媒体的动态加载内容,这样读者更容易理解。
展望未来,讨论技术的发展,比如移动设备的重要性,AI在动态设计中的应用,这样文章会显得更有深度。
在写作过程中,要注意逻辑清晰,段落分明,每个部分都要有足够的解释和例子支持,这样不仅满足字数要求,还能让读者全面了解动态网站设计的重要性和应用。
动态网站设计作业:从静态到动态的网站设计演变
在当今互联网快速发展的时代,网站设计已经从静态的页面展示发展成为动态的交互式平台,动态网站设计作业不仅仅是对传统静态网页设计的简单升级,更是对用户体验和网站功能的全面优化,通过动态网站设计作业,我们可以深入了解现代网站设计的核心理念,掌握最新的技术工具,提升网站的整体竞争力,本文将从静态设计到动态设计的演变过程,分析动态网站设计的重要性,并探讨其未来发展趋势。
静态网站设计的局限性
静态网站设计是网站设计的起点,它通过HTML、CSS等技术实现页面的展示和布局,静态网站虽然在页面加载速度和资源占用方面具有一定的优势,但在用户体验和功能交互方面存在明显的局限性。
静态网站在页面加载时需要从服务器读取所有内容,导致页面加载时间较长,尤其是在移动设备上,由于屏幕尺寸的缩小和用户需求的多样化,静态网站的加载速度和用户体验无法满足现代用户的需求。
静态网站缺乏交互性,用户在浏览静态网站时,只能通过简单的点击和下拉菜单进行操作,无法实现更复杂的交互功能,这种单一的交互方式限制了网站的功能性和用户参与度。
静态网站的更新和维护成本较高,由于静态网站需要通过HTTP GET请求的方式加载内容,网站管理员需要在服务器端进行频繁的更新和维护,这对资源和技术能力提出了较高的要求。
动态网站设计的优势
动态网站设计通过引入JavaScript、PHP、Node.js等技术,实现了页面内容的动态加载和交互式的用户操作,动态网站设计作业的优势主要体现在以下几个方面:
提升用户体验
动态网站设计通过响应式设计和交互式元素的加载,能够显著提升用户的浏览体验,用户在浏览网页时,可以实时看到页面内容的更新和变化,无需等待页面加载完成。增强网站功能
动态网站设计支持多种功能,如用户登录、购物车管理、在线支付等,通过动态交互,网站可以实现更加复杂的业务逻辑,提升网站的功能性和实用性。降低维护成本
动态网站设计通过将逻辑代码和数据分离,使得网站的维护和更新更加便捷,开发人员可以通过代码的方式实现页面的动态更新,而无需频繁修改服务器端的配置。适应快速变化的需求
在互联网快速发展的背景下,动态网站设计能够快速适应市场需求的变化,通过动态加载的内容和交互式功能,网站可以更好地满足用户的需求,保持竞争力。
动态网站设计的技术实现
动态网站设计作业的核心在于掌握现代前端和后端技术,以下是动态网站设计中常用的技术和工具:
前端技术
前端技术主要包括JavaScript、CSS和HTML,JavaScript用于实现页面的动态交互和数据处理,CSS用于实现页面的样式设计,HTML用于页面的结构化构建。后端技术
后端技术主要包括PHP、Node.js和Python,PHP和Node.js是常用的服务器端编程语言,用于处理动态数据和逻辑计算,Python则常用于数据分析和自动化任务。数据库技术
数据库技术是动态网站设计的重要组成部分,数据库用于存储和管理网站的数据,包括用户信息、商品信息、订单信息等,常见的数据库技术有MySQL、MongoDB和PostgreSQL。框架和工具
框架和工具是动态网站设计中常用的工具,如React、Vue.js、Django、ElasticUI等,这些框架和工具能够简化开发过程,提高开发效率。
动态网站设计的案例分析
为了更好地理解动态网站设计的应用,我们可以通过实际案例来分析其设计思路和实现过程。
电商网站的动态设计
在电商网站中,动态设计的应用尤为突出,通过动态加载商品信息和客户评价,用户可以更直观地了解商品的详细信息,用户在浏览某商品时,可以通过滚动页面查看更多的商品详情,或者通过点击“查看商品详情”按钮进入详情页面。
社交媒体平台的动态设计
在社交媒体平台上,动态设计的应用也非常广泛,通过动态加载用户的点赞、评论和分享功能,用户可以更便捷地参与互动,用户在浏览一篇文章时,可以通过点击“点赞”按钮增加点赞数,或者通过点击“分享”按钮将文章分享到社交媒体。
在线教育平台的动态设计
在在线教育平台中,动态设计的应用同样重要,通过动态加载课程视频和学习资料,用户可以更灵活地安排学习时间,用户在观看课程视频时,可以通过点击“暂停”按钮暂停视频,或者通过点击“返回目录”按钮回到课程的目录页面。
动态网站设计的未来发展趋势
随着技术的不断进步和市场需求的变化,动态网站设计的未来发展趋势将更加多元化和复杂化,以下是一些可能的发展方向:
人工智能与动态设计的结合
人工智能技术的引入将显著提升动态网站设计的智能化水平,通过机器学习算法,动态网站可以根据用户的行为和偏好,自适应地调整页面内容和交互方式。增强现实与虚拟现实技术的应用
增强现实(AR)和虚拟现实(VR)技术的引入将为动态网站设计带来全新的体验,通过AR和VR技术,用户可以在虚拟环境中体验网站内容,提升互动性和沉浸感。微前端与后端分离技术的发展
微前端与后端分离技术的进一步发展将使得动态网站设计更加高效和灵活,通过将前端和后端功能分离,开发人员可以更方便地管理和维护网站的逻辑和数据。区块链技术的应用
区块链技术的引入将为动态网站设计带来新的可能性,通过区块链技术,动态网站可以实现内容的不可篡改性和数据的透明性,提升网站的可信度和安全性。
动态网站设计作业不仅仅是对传统静态设计的简单升级,更是对现代网站设计核心理念的全面实践,通过动态网站设计,我们可以实现页面内容的动态加载和交互式的用户操作,显著提升用户体验和网站功能,动态网站设计的未来发展趋势将更加多元化和智能化,为网站设计带来了更多的可能性。
在动态网站设计作业中,我们需要深入理解现代网站设计的核心理念,掌握最新的技术和工具,提升自己的设计能力和开发水平,通过不断学习和实践,我们可以设计出更加优秀和实用的动态网站,满足用户的需求,实现网站的商业价值。
相关文章
